The Z80 instruction set lives on via the eZ80, Z180 and others which are binary compatible with the original Z80 instruction set. Unfortunately Zilog stopped making the 40 pin DIP package a couple years ago so yeah this specific board will be hard to source. You can still find them on gray market, mostly ones that have been desoldered from existing boards.
Even if you made a version of this board with the footprint changed to the QFP eZ80, it probably wouldn't work because the eZ80 has different memory mapping and clocking differences.
